Could you show me how to divide x^3 + 2x^2 + x + 2 by x^2 + 1

Respuesta :

sanchezmonica
sanchezmonica sanchezmonica
  • 24-07-2019

Answer:

[tex]x+2[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

For this division we can first use factoring of the numerator, then eliminate the common factors.

[tex]\frac{x^{3} +2x^{2} +x+2}{x^{2}+1 }[/tex]

Factoring the numerator by the term grouping method

[tex]\frac{x^{2} (x+2)+(x+2) }{x^{2} +1}[/tex]

[tex]\frac{(x^{2} +1)(x+2)}{x^{2} +1}[/tex]

removed terms

[tex](x+2)[/tex]
